This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ision Next revision Both sides next revision | ||
start:student_projects_deploy [2022/12/07 06:30] mark [Веб-приложения] |
start:student_projects_deploy [2023/08/03 17:54] mark [Веб-приложения] |
||
---|---|---|---|
Line 14: | Line 14: | ||
* она располагается в отдельном контейнере | * она располагается в отдельном контейнере | ||
* каталог с файлами данных СУБД монтируется в volume (отдельный или в каталог машины-хоста) | * каталог с файлами данных СУБД монтируется в volume (отдельный или в каталог машины-хоста) | ||
+ | * контейнеру СУБД не нужно открывать никаких портов | ||
* режим сети не host для docker-compose | * режим сети не host для docker-compose | ||
* конфигурация docker-compose открывает только необходимые порты для production работы (идеально - только фронтенд) | * конфигурация docker-compose открывает только необходимые порты для production работы (идеально - только фронтенд) | ||
+ | * все порты в docker-compose открываются только с указанием на 127.0.0.1 (то есть - так можно 127.0.0.1:8000:8000, а так - 8000:8000 нельзя) | ||
* веб-интерфейс доступен на порте с номером от 5000 | * веб-интерфейс доступен на порте с номером от 5000 | ||
* есть конфиг для apache2, настраивающий работу через reverse proxy | * есть конфиг для apache2, настраивающий работу через reverse proxy |